Brilio.net - Aging of the scalp is the main cause of gray hair. In this process, melanocyte cells in the hair follicles produce melanin in decreasing amounts, until they finally stop. As a result, the hair turns gray or white.

Deficiencies in nutrients like vitamin B12, copper, and zinc can speed up this change, as all three play a role in melanin production. While gray hair can be a cause for concern, there are natural ways to prevent it.

One tip comes from YouTube user razdarkitchen, who uses black tea as a solution. Black tea is rich in antioxidants and polyphenols, which help fight free radical damage and keep hair healthy and naturally colored.

The content of black tea not only fights free radicals, but also maintains the health of hair follicles and slows the appearance of gray hair. The caffeine in black tea stimulates blood circulation in the scalp, helping to prevent gray hair. If added with aloe vera, hair will be more moisturized thanks to its natural soothing properties.

Not stopping there, additional ingredients such as fenugreek or methi seeds also provide extraordinary benefits. The content of protein, lecithin, and nicotinate can stimulate healthy hair growth while preventing damage. The combination of these three ingredients is effective in overcoming inflammation, protecting hair from damage, and inhibiting the growth of gray hair.

Ingredients:

photo: YouTube/@razdarkitchen

1. 1/2 aloe vera
2. 2 tablespoons black tea
3. 2 tablespoons fenugreek seeds.
4. Shampoo

How to make:

photo: YouTube/@razdarkitchen

1. Put fenugreek in a pan
2. Add black tea
3. Mix with the cleaned aloe vera pieces.
4. Pour in enough clean water
5. Boil for about five minutes, while stirring.
6. Pour the boiled water into a bowl, while straining it.
7. Cool and add one tablespoon of shampoo.
8. Stir again until all ingredients are mixed.

How to use:

photo: YouTube/@razdarkitchen

1. Tidy your hair first
2. Apply the boiled water to all layers of hair.
3. Let stand for about five minutes
4. Then, rinse using clean water
5. To get maximum results, use this concoction approximately three times a week.
